Baby Day
Greg and Amanda Day head up to Hoosier Pass outside of Breckenridge Colorado to reveal the gender of their first baby in the most Colorado of ways - on skis!
Greg and Amanda came to Dustin Farrenkopf Films with a vision for revealing the gender of their first child - one that felt true to who they are. The plan: skin into the backcountry with a small group of close friends, drop in from the summit, and reveal the gender using colored smoke bombs attached to ski poles - while Amanda and friends watched from below.
Knowing there would be no second take, DFF built a small crew and carefully choreographed coverage across the mountain. Multiple POV cameras captured the skiers’ perspective, while I rigged a MoVI and snowboarded alongside the soon-to-be father to bring an immersive, real-time energy to the moment.
The result is a piece that blends scale, emotion, and spontaneity - capturing a once-in-a-lifetime reveal as it unfolded. The final video was later picked up and shared across the Denver news cycle.
